Ken-chan's game report digest
On the road against the D-backs, Ohtani went wild on the mound AND at the plate. At bat he reached base in all 5 plate appearances, and on the mound he dealt — just 2 hits allowed with 6 strikeouts. The team rolled to a 7-0 shutout. What a perfect day.
- Ohtani reaches base in all 5 plate appearances (3 hits, 2 walks)
- Ohtani starts on the mound: 2 hits, 6 Ks, no runs (two-way day)
- Tucker's 424-ft shot to right-center in the 2nd opens the scoring in a 7-0 shutout
